Mining is a dangerous industry according to the United States Department of Labor. In 2017, for example, coal mining deaths surged to 15, a year after its safest year ever in 2016 with only eight deaths.

Every year there are deaths in other kinds of mines as well, nearly 250 in mines of all kinds including coal between 2011 and 2017, according to the federal Mine Safety and Health Administration. And that doesn’t take into account lung disease (black lung), hearing loss and ongoing health issues that miners face from their occupation.

Safety training and technology help is on the way. Increasingly, mobile apps are being used to cut down on fatalities and injuries, and help make sure that miners don’t face the kinds of hazardous conditions that can affect their health. The Canadian Mining Journal notes that traditionally, mining safety programs have relied on paper forms, Excel and manual processes. But it concludes, “For mine operators seeking to enhance worker and site-safety reporting, and compliance, switching from paper forms and Excel spreadsheets to mobile apps offers several key benefits.”

Particularly important, the journal says, are the use of mobile apps rather than paper for site inspections. Paper is limited to text-only input, can be misread, and using it can take days for important safety information to get to the right person.

Mobile apps, the journal says, “ensure inspections are being done correctly and in accordance with company and industry regulations. Mobile inspection apps also allow for multimedia (photos, etc.) to more easily report complicated issues and provide visual proof as needed.” And they can get safety information to the right person fast with a swipe or a tap.

The journal notes that mobile apps can also improve mine self-auditing programs, such as for fire prevention, handling electrical dangers and more. These apps could record amounts of coal dust, distribution of hearing protection and more. It concludes, “For mine operators grappling with how to manage worker and site-safety compliance, and reporting cost-effectively and efficiently, mobile apps provide a compelling approach relative to paper forms and manual processes.”

One potential issue with the use of mobile apps for mine is lack of WIFI and cell signal underground. But Sudeep Pasricha, associate professor of Electrical and Computer Engineering and Computer Science at Colorado State University, has done research to develop underground communications networks that are more reliable and safer than those used currently. He notes such networks “could not only improve the safety of hundreds of thousands of American miners, but also offer new opportunities for communications and improving human safety in a variety of extreme environments.”
